Transaction 73986fffc47c588efee04c393f31ee27495c74c0e6ccb82e406a3c2b52558a91
1 Input
1 Output
-
73986fffc47c588efee04c393f31ee27495c74c0e6ccb82e406a3c2b52558a91:0
- value
- 235245
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f75a1a001e8049fecf32345c4d383e147c4ac4d
- address
- bc1q3a66rgqpaqzflm8nydzuf5uru9ruftzdun8j2m